Starting from August, the country will concentrate on investigating and punishing prominent traffic violations
According to the unified deployment of the Ministry of Public Security, starting from August, various regions across the country will carry out regional campaigns for summer traffic safety rectification, focusing on investigating and punishing outstanding traffic violations, rectifying serious source risk hazards, exposing drivers of serious traffic violations, and strictly preventing major traffic accidents to ensure the continuous stability of summer road traffic safety situation.
Beijing, Tianjin, Hebei, Shanxi, Inner Mongolia, Jilin, Liaoning, and Heilongjiang jointly organized the Northeast and North China Summer Traffic Safety Improvement Action Regional Campaign. From August 1st to 10th, we will focus on the peak summer travel season for the public and carry out a special action to safeguard safety during the peak tourism season; From September 1st to 10th, we will focus on the traffic safety of primary, secondary, and tertiary school students at the beginning of the school year, as well as the traffic safety during the busy farming season in rural areas. We will launch a special action to protect agriculture and students for safe travel. The public security and traffic management departments of 8 provinces will establish a mechanism for transmitting information on key traffic violations. For drunk driving, serious overloading, serious "double violations" and other illegal behaviors of drivers from the Northeast and North China regions who are investigated and dealt with locally, as well as typical road traffic accidents, the information will be transmitted to the local traffic management department for exposure in local media.
From August 1st to 10th, the public security and traffic management departments of 13 provinces in the East and Central South regions of China, including Shanghai, Jiangsu, Zhejiang, Anhui, Fujian, Jiangxi, Shandong, Henan, Hubei, Hunan, Guangdong, Guangxi, and Hainan, conducted a concentrated battle to strictly investigate and punish traffic violations such as overcrowding, illegal modification, and fatigue driving of passenger cars. They increased patrol control and law enforcement efforts during key time periods, and made every effort to purify the traffic environment.
The public security and traffic management departments of Chongqing, Sichuan, Guizhou, Yunnan, Xizang, Shaanxi, Gansu, Qinghai, Ningxia, Xinjiang, and Xinjiang Production and Construction Corps in the southwest and northwest regions carried out a concentrated battle in two batches. From August 3 to 13, they focused on highway buses, tourist buses, and hazardous chemical transport vehicles, and strictly investigated traffic violations such as "three overloads and one fatigue", violation of traffic bans and restrictions, and failure to use seat belts as required; From September 15th to 25th, traffic violations such as "three overloads and one fatigue" and drunk driving will be strictly investigated for heavy and medium-sized trucks, small buses with 6 or more seats, and small buses with 5 or less seats.
The public security traffic management department reminds that summer is the peak season for travel and also a period of high incidence of traffic violations. Traffic safety should always be kept in mind. Driving must strictly comply with laws and regulations, pay attention to road conditions and weather in advance, arrange travel reasonably, and minimize driving during severe weather such as heavy rainfall and typhoons; Remember not to drink or drive while driving, and consciously resist illegal and criminal acts of drunk driving; Do not illegally overcrowd, overload, or carry passengers, and do not exceed the speed limit, fatigue driving, or distracted driving. When traveling by car, it is necessary to take a safe and compliant vehicle, and all staff must fasten their seat belts throughout the journey. Do not take overloaded buses, illegal operating vehicles, as well as non passenger vehicles such as trucks, tricycles, and tractors.
